NAIROBI CITY TOUR |
|
The tour covers the modern city center, the busy Nairobi market, the highly esteemed parliament building, the prestigious Kenyatta conference center, the railway museum and the renowned national museum. There are heart failing displays of the early man, an arena of African regalia and consortium of the flora and the fauna of Kenya . Adjacent to this is the snake park where there are variety species of snakes, crocodiles, tortoise lizards and more. |

KAREN BLIXEN MUSEUM & GIRAFFE MANOR |

|
Karen Blixen‘s home in the shadow of Ngong Hills now a national museum is the main feature of this tour. Tea is at the A FEW Giraffe center where a film on the huge animals is shown, and where the famous “Daisy “Rothschild Giraffe roam freely in the grounds of giraffe center followed by a visit to an ostrich farm and the chance to shop at the superb craft village on the ground. |

NAIROBI NATIONAL PARK |
|
Just a few kilometers from the bustling city of Nairobi is unique wildlife sanctuary, which has over 50 species of animals including four of the big five. The tour also cover animal orphanage, which is miniature through non-exhaustive, representation of the park. |

LAKE NAKURU NATIONAL PARK |
|
The Great Rift Valley stretches from Ethiopia across Kenya to Tanzania . It boast of a chain of 8 lakes, L. Nakuru being one of the most famous. The lake is only a few kilometers from Nakuru Kenya 's 3 rd largest town 160km west of Nairobi . You will descend the escarpment unto the drastic landscape of the scenic rift. You will be treated to an extensive tour to the park, with lunch being served in the park. The tour will focus on bewildering spectacle of million flamingos and the variety of wildlife with which the park a bounds. On the journey back to Nairobi a stop at lake Naivasha where Kenya tea is served is most appropriate. Here you will be treated to a melody of songs from a wide variety of birds. |

AMBOSELI EXPRESS |

|
Amboseli National Park is situated within a shadow of the mighty 3-peaked Kilimanjaro, African highest mountain. Nature and only nature is her majesty could create such a backdrop to the myriad of wildlife abounding at the park. En route the park, which crosses ochre plains where the Maasai tend their herds in an old age tradition. Lunch is served at the lodge in the park and afterwards another game drive where lion, elephant, and the spotted cheater are all likely to be seen. Return to Nairobi in time for dinner. |

SOLIO RANCH-SUPERB RHINO |
|
Leaving Nairobi after lunch you drive through rolling Kikuyu agricultural country to reached the out span hotel in the early evening in time for a shower before dinner. Early in the next morning you drive a short distance to Solio ranch. The unique cattle and wildlife ranch lies in a valley with superb views of both the Aberdare ranges and MT Kenya. The day is spent in the protected wildlife area of the ranch viewing blank and white rhinocerous, as well as the lion, cheater, multitudes of game and possibly even the shy leopard. A site has been selected for your picnic lunch, and you drive back to Nairobi in the early evening. |
